Wine tasting events provide an intriguing backdrop for enthusiasts and connoisseurs to interact with the complexities of wine, significantly in terms of comparing vintages. Each vintage tells a story of climate, harvest situations, and winemaking techniques that affect the characteristics of the finished product. Subsequently, attending a winery wine tasting event can turn into an enlightening experience, permitting people to explore the nuanced differences throughout several years of production.
During such events, attendees typically have the chance to style a number of wines from the identical winery however across completely different vintages. This comparative tasting helps reveal how each year's particular climatic conditions affected the grapes and subsequently the wine's flavor profile. For example, a wet rising season could produce wines which are fruitier and extra minerally, whereas a dry year could lead to bolder, more concentrated flavors. The impact of environmental variables helps to color a comprehensive image of what each vintage represents.

One of the elemental aspects of comparing vintages is understanding the significance of terroir, the distinctive environmental situations of a selected vineyard website. Terroir encompasses soil composition, climate, and the micro-ecosystem that collectively shape the traits of the grapes grown there. Vintages from the identical property can differ significantly when climate patterns fluctuate from yr to year, illustrating how terroir interacts with local weather to provide distinctive wines.
When tasting varied vintages, one often notices the evolution of fruit flavors and supporting buildings like acidity and tannins. A younger wine may showcase fresh, vibrant fruit traits that may fade with age, whereas older vintages may reveal extra complexity, together with tertiary aromas and flavors like leather, tobacco, or dried fruits. These changes happen because of gradual chemical reactions that develop over time, providing a fascinating realm for exploration during tastings.

Wine aging is one other important factor that can be explored during vintage comparisons. Many wines take pleasure in getting older, permitting flavors to combine and mellow over time. Nonetheless, not all wines are appropriate for long-term cellaring. Understanding which vintages would possibly stand the test of time versus those best enjoyed young could be a valuable lesson for novices and seasoned drinkers alike.
Wine style can be a significant level of comparison. For instance, a vineyard might produce both an estate vintage and a reserve vintage. The differences in manufacturing strategies, together with choice standards for grapes and aging techniques, can yield markedly different wines. Comparing these styles from varied vintages can highlight the range inside the similar winery, illustrating the winemaker's philosophy and the impact of every year’s conditions.

A vintage refers back to the yr by which the grapes had been harvested to produce a specific wine. Every vintage can exhibit completely different characteristics based on weather situations, grape high quality, and winemaking techniques during that year - Experience the Secret Treasures of Sebastopol Wineries.
Why is it important to check totally different vintages throughout a wine tasting event?
Comparing vintages permits tasters to understand how environmental components and winemaking practices affect the flavor and high quality of the wine. It helps develop a more nuanced palate and appreciation for the complexity of wines from the identical winery over totally different years.

How does climate affect wine vintages?
Climate performs a vital function in the growing season, influencing grape ripeness, flavor development, and overall quality. A notably scorching or wet yr can result in vital variations within the wine produced, making some vintages standout in comparability with others.
